Transaction cde91857ecfe83aa86d3a168bc3a57561756987668c98e4f153248bd20eb620c
1 Input
1 Output
-
cde91857ecfe83aa86d3a168bc3a57561756987668c98e4f153248bd20eb620c:0
- value
- 508076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d01cf17e68c53dc60eb3974dd9416aa46f4fc44 OP_EQUAL
- address
- 37FbJw8P9vH5R9gvtbYNTtF6T291SgmTdV